
This role provides excellent service to all guests who approach the bar. Keeps the bar area cleaned and always stocked. Assists the Bartender with various duties.
Cleans bar area, including bar tops, sinks, glasses, refrigerators, and other bar appliances.
Acknowledges, greets, and converses in English with customers who approach the bar.
Prepares and pours all types of drinks for customers and cocktail servers upon request.
Processes all cash transactions by accepting money and making necessary change accurately, while presenting customer with bar receipt.
Manually pushes cart loaded with beer from the keg room to the various bars at least twice during shift.
Converts cash to coin for any customers playing the slot machines in the bar area.
Calls a designated slot employee when needed by a guest or bartender.
Meets the attendance guidelines of the job and adheres to regulatory, departmental and company policies.
• Six months previous experience as a Bartender or Bar Helper preferred.
• Minimum of one-year customer service experience in a previous position, where the primary job duty is direct customer service is preferred.
• Previous money-handling and cash register experience is preferred.
• Must possess excellent customer service and communication skills.
• Must be 21 years of age.
• Must be able to work any day of the week and any shift.
• Must be able to communicate with guests to meet their immediate needs.
• Must be able to get along with co-workers and work as a team.
• Must present a well-groomed appearance.
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S
• Must be able to work inside assigned bar area in the casino/hotel.
• Must be able to lift items up to 75 pounds and manually push up to 650 pounds.
• Must be able to bend, pull and carry bar stock to refrigerators and cabinets.
• Must be able to use hand motion when preparing and pouring all types of drinks for customers and cocktail servers.
• Must be able to use hand motion when cleaning and wiping bar counters.
• Must be able to complete required paperwork for cash transactions.
• Must be able to operate cash register, two- and six-wheel carts, juice, soda and liquor guns, cutting boards, coffee and frozen drink machines, ice machines, shot glasses, mixers, pourers, blenders, beer keg/soda/wine/juice hook-ups and knives.
• Must be able to listen and respond to visual and aural cues.
• Must be able to read, write, speak, and understand English.
• Must be able to tolerate areas containing secondhand smoke, high noise levels, bright lights, and dust.

Caesars Entertainment, Inc. is the largest casino-entertainment Company in the U.S. and one of the world's most diversified casino-entertainment providers. Since its beginning in Reno, NV, in 1937, Caesars Entertainment, Inc. has grown through development of new resorts, expansions and acquisitions. Caesars Entertainment, Inc.'s resorts operate primarily under the Caesars®, Harrah's®, Horseshoe®, and Eldorado® brand names. Caesars Entertainment, Inc. offers diversified gaming, entertainment and hospitality amenities, one-of-a-kind destinations, and a full suite of mobile and online gaming and sports betting experiences.
